Is any financial assistance available?

Recognizing that the costs can be an obstacle for some families, Beginnings has established an Adoption Assistance Reserve Fund. Prospective adoptive families are welcome to apply for assistance and are considered on a needs basis. You may also qualify for a designated adoption loan through the City Bank Since February 2007, there is a tax credit (up to $10,000) for adoption expenses on your income taxes. Check with an accountant or tax specialist regarding how this is applied.
